Monique Lhuillier Spring 2011 RTW

While I so enjoy being casual in comfy jeans and cozy sweaters - there is nothing I love more than an evening wear line. Evening wear always reminds me of when my parents would go out to fabulous parties or work events, getting dressed up in glamorous pieces. Monique Lhuillier's Spring 2011 line was just that - glamorous shimmery evening wear. Flirty dresses and tailored pants kept this line extremely feminine. Of course there were her signature gowns - always a fav. Although a color palette of metallic reds, pinks, golds and creams were mainly used, Lhuillier also added quite a few prints throughout the collection. There were few surprise elements thrown in like a bright green gown and a blue ruffled floor length dress.
